+ **Why it's not zero**: EFS requires Lambda to run in a VPC. EFS itself is accessed via mount targets in the VPC (no endpoint needed). But VPC Lambda can't reach other AWS services (DynamoDB, S3) over the public internet — it needs either a NAT Gateway ($32/mo — too expensive) or VPC endpoints. Gateway endpoints (DynamoDB, S3) are free. Interface endpoints (Secrets Manager) cost ~$7/mo/AZ — only needed when Secrets Manager is introduced pre-launch (Phase 4). Bedrock and SQS endpoints were originally planned but have been eliminated by switching to DynamoDB Streams and local MiniLM embeddings.
